It is produced by the reaction of ethylene gas with bromine, in a classic halogen addition reaction: CH 2 =CH 2 + Br 2 → BrCH 2 –CH 2 Br. The highest electron density in the π orbital is right in the middle, between the two carbon atoms, so this is where we expect the bromine to attack. The mechanism of reaction between ethene and bromine is an electrophilic addition reaction. ethene + bromine : C2H4 + Br2 --> CH2BrCH2Br (1,2-dibromoethane ) This is an addition reaction, in which the double bond of ethene is broken as a bromine atom becomes attached to each of the carbon atoms. ADDITION OF BROMINE: CH2=CH2 +Br2 CH2Br-CH2Br (1,2-dibromoethane) ADDITION OF IODINE: CH2=CH2 + I2 CH2I-CH2I (1,2-diiodoethane) ADDITION OF HYDROGEN: When a mixture of ethene and hydrogen is passed over finely divided nickel, hydrogen is added to ethene with the formation of ethane. On the other hand, bromine has a characterstic red-orange colour. Historically, 1,2-dibromoethane was used as a component in anti-knock additives in leaded fuels.
